  • I'm really glad you decided to call out Ghost Adventures. In a recent season, they came to my town and "investigated" the death of a woman without asking permission from her family. Her daughter had to make a yt video saying that her mother did not die because of demonic possession, she was on drugs and fell over a concrete slab into a creek. They also talked to an elderly man about our town's "demons" and this man has dementia. They exploited him for their story. I used to watch them with my family all the time but now our whole town despises the GA team. Edit: how the fuck did someone make this into a vegan propaganda message. Also, the video is now private but if you look up "Biggs Ghost Adventures Daughter", the first article recites and refers to the video I've mentioned here. Links usually make comments disappear so I can't post it on here :/

  • As an electronics engineer, the "hunting devices" are hilarious to me. EM frequencies are going to vary any time someone's cellphone tries to get reception. The other gadgets are also probably messing with it. A radio that's flipping through a bunch of stations is going to pick up little clips of stations and if it picks up talking stations (more likely to happen if it's using AM also) it's going to put together some words, and our brains desperately try to make anything that sounds like words make sense.
